On Sunday, the Chicago Cubs played the Seattle Mariners once again, adding another win to their Spring record. The Cubs had a great sixth inning, putting up three runs. Carlos Zambrano started the scoring off for the Cubs with a run in the fifth inning. Alfonso Soriano added a two run single in the sixth inning. On the mound, Zambrano was on fire! He had six strike outs during his six innings pitching, and he only gave up four hits the entire game.
